[. . . ] Note for using the Number on the remote control: ¡When selecting cable channels which are higher than 99, press +100 first, then, press the last two digits. (Example: to select channel 125, first press "+100" then press "2" and "5"). ¡You must precede single-digit channel numbers with a zero (For example: 02, 03, 04 and so on). The default code is 0000. ____ 3 Select "TV RATING" ­ V-CHIP SET UP ­ B TV RATING MPAA RATING CHANGE CODE Press K or L to point to "TV RATING". Then, press ENTER. 4 Select your desired item B TV­Y TV­Y7 ( TV­G TV­PG ( TV­14 ( TV­MA ( ) ) ) ) [VIEW] [VIEW] [VIEW] [VIEW] [VIEW] [VIEW] When you select TV-Y7, TV-PG, TV-14, or TV-MA and you press ENTER, the sub-ratings will appear on the TV screen. If you select the rating category (example: TV-PG) and turn it [BLOCK] or [VIEW], the sub-ratings (example: V for Violence) will turn [BLOCK] or [VIEW] automatically. You can set the sub-ratings to [BLOCK] or [VIEW] individually when the rating category is set to [BLOCK]. · When you select [TV-Y7]: Press L or K to select "FV" (Fantasy Violence). · When you select [TV-PG], [TV-14] or [TV-MA]: Press L or K to select "D"(Suggestive Dialog), "L"(Coarse Language), "S"(Sexual Situation), or "V"(Violence). NOTE: When you select [TV-MA], "D" does not appear on the TV screen. · The sub-ratings which set to [BLOCK] appears next to the rating category in the TV RATING menu.
